I had seen this recipe on the web somewhere and tucked it in the back of my mind, as due to health reasons and personal preference, we enjoy angel food cakes. For those of you who haven't tried it yet, I just wanted to pass on that it got rave reviews not only from my guests but from my 4 children, which surprised me!
1 box Angel Food Cake Mix (I used Betty Crocker's) 1 1/4 cup water 1/4 cup cocoa, sifted 1/4-1/2 tsp. Hershey's chocolate syrup
Combine flour packet from the mix & cocoa, then prepare cake according to pkg. directions. Add choc. syrup to batter (1/4 tsp. didn't seem to do it for me, so I added a squirt more...). Pour batter into your ungreased tube pan and pop into a preheated 350 oven on the bottom rack for 37-47 minutes (I was worried about the 2-hour suggested cooling time, inverted of course, but this was not a problem for us. By the time we had dinner and were ready for cake and coffee, this puppy was ready to go, no problem, when I took it out of the pan about 1 1/2 hrs. later!)
